Eastern Cham[edit]

Alternative forms[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Proto-Malayo-Polynesian *qanitu, from Proto-Austronesian *qaNiCu. Related to Indonesian hantu.

Pronunciation[edit]

Noun[edit]

atuw

  1. soul; spirit of the dead; corpse
